How much can a 3.5 EcoBoost tow?

The 3.5L EcoBoost® towing capacity is 13,200 lbs., making it the top dog for the 2020 F-150. When properly equipped, expect to haul up to 3,230 lbs. of payload capacity in addition to the trailer you’re towing. The 3.5L EcoBoost® is paired with a ten-speed automatic transmission and the specs are 375 HP and 470 lb.

Can a Ford f150 tow 8000 lbs?

The short answer is that most modern-day F-150s can safely pull a travel trailer that weight around 5,000 to 8,000 pounds with gear, depending on the engine, rear-axle ratio and addition of available options.

How do I know if my F-150 has max tow package?

You will be able to tell if your F150 has the max tow package by looking at the owner’s manual for your vehicle and determining what it is. If you have misplaced the owner’s manual, or the previous owner did, you can contact Ford and check via the vehicle’s VIN. The VIN will be displayed in the window of your truck.

How big of a camper can a Ford F150 pull?

The F-150 can tow up to 13,200 lbs with the right trim level and tow package. However, when it comes to towing a travel trailer, most (but not all) F-150 models can safely pull a camper that’s under 6,000 lbs.

What trucks can tow 40000 lbs?

The largest pickup available, the 2015 Ford F-450, gained 7,000 lb. in gross combined weight (GCW) rating to reach 40,000 lb.; half the capacity of a typical Class 8 truck. It offers a maximum fifth wheel/gooseneck towing capacity of 31,200 lb., measured using the Society of Automotive Engineers J2807 standard.

How big of a truck do I need to tow a truck?

Ford F-150 3.5L EcoBoost V6 4X2 157″ WB (SuperCrew with 6.5″ box) with 3.73 axle ratio has up to 13,200 lbs of max trailering capacity for conventional towing. This will require the Max Trailer Tow Package and 20″ wheels and tires. The same truck but in 4X4 is capable of 12,900 lbs.
